Business Support Assistant Estates (covering Midlands area)

Heritage is for everybody, and we are here for heritage.

Heritage lives in places and people, memories and stories, artefacts and traditions. It can connect us all to the past, and to each other. It can make us happier, strengthen every community, and help shape society for the better. Everybody should be able to enjoy the benefits it brings.

That's why, as a charity, we care for over a million objects and hundreds of historic sites in every part of England, from international icons to local treasures. And it's why we open them up, share their stories and find new ways for everybody to enjoy, learn, play and create.

We are looking for a Business Support Assistant to join our team. The role is part time and permanent, working 28.8 hours per week.

We offer flexible working arrangements where the role allows. This role can be based at one of our sites or offices, at home, or worked on a hybrid pattern. You will be required to attend Kenilworth Castle on a frequent basis. This will be discussed further at interview.

This is a great opportunity for a skilled administrator to join the West regional team, supporting the important conservation work being carried out across our impressive portfolio of sites throughout West England.

Role responsibilities

As a Business Support Assistant, you will you will coordinate meetings, prepare agendas and take accurate meeting minutes. You will also assist site teams with the management of external suppliers by planning site visits and annual schedules, processing invoices and monitoring contractor/supplier performance. You will also help to monitor progress of essential works across the the team.

To be considered as a Business Support Assistant, you'll need:
  • Experience coordinating meetings, preparing agendas and taking meeting minutes.
  • Experience of working with financial information and budgets.
  • The ability to multi-task, manage own workload and prioritise accordingly to meet deadlines in a fast-paced changing environment.
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ills with a high level of accuracy and attention to detail.
  • Advanced knowledge of the full Microsoft Office suite.
